Accreditation and Quality Assurance
Ensuring that your online Healthcare degree in Hays, KS comes from an accredited institution is paramount for both academic credibility and professional validation. Prospective students should verify regional accreditation—typically granted by the Higher Learning Commission (HLC)—as well as relevant programmatic accrediting bodies such as the Commission on Accreditation for Health Informatics and Information Management Education (CAHIIM) for informatics tracks, and the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Management Education (CAHME) for administration specializations. Accreditation not only confirms that a program meets rigorous educational standards but also impacts your eligibility for federal financial aid, smooth credit transfers, and qualification for industry certifications.
Accredited programs undergo regular review cycles that assess curriculum relevance, faculty qualifications, student outcomes, and continuous improvement processes. For example, CAHIIM-accredited health informatics curricula must demonstrate proficiency in data analytics, electronic health record management, and privacy standards—critical competencies that employers in Hays clinics and hospitals highly value. Similarly, CAHME-accredited healthcare administration programs are required to integrate case studies, leadership simulations, and strategic management modules that prepare graduates for C-suite roles.
Before applying, consult each institution’s accreditation disclosures on their website and cross-reference with accreditor directories.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) for Online Healthcare Master’s Programs in Hays, KS
Q: What types of accreditation should I verify before applying?
A: Ensure the program is accredited by the U.S. Department of Education and recognized bodies like the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Management Education (CAHME) or the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E). Accreditation guarantees curriculum quality, eases credit transfers, and enhances employer recognition.
Q: Do fully online master’s programs require any on-site clinical or lab components?
A: Yes, most accredited online healthcare master’s degrees include a practicum or simulation lab. Institutions partner with local clinics and hospitals, allowing you to complete hands-on hours near Hays under professional supervision.
Q: What technical and academic prerequisites must I meet?
A: Common requirements include a bachelor’s degree in a relevant field, a minimum GPA (often 3.0), standardized test scores if required, basic computer literacy, reliable high-speed internet, and current certifications (e.g., BLS/CPR) for clinical specializations.
Q: How long will it take to complete the master’s program?
A: Full-time students typically finish in 1 to 2 years; part-time pacing can extend completion to 3 years. Program structures vary—some offer accelerated terms, while others provide modular scheduling to fit busy professionals.
